When I first discovered this site, there was a member who hosted Dubai. Unfortunately he moved and the feed was gone. The feed was clear and strong with tower/gnd. and app./dep. scanning. You could also hear traffic in and out of Sharjah and handoffs to Shiraz and Bandar Abbas in Iran to the north plus eastbounds to Muscat Radio heading towards the Arabian Sea. It was so interesting with the different traffic that I sourced out maps and Dubai ground taxing charts to follow the traffic. Too bad a few weeks after I got the charts the feed was gone. :(
Other than the LHR feed here for a short time, I think DXB feed was one of the best feeds from far of places.
